Document Imaging Supervisor jobs in Richland, WA

Document Imaging Supervisor oversees personnel responsible for operating document imaging equipment for use in the creation of images or text. Document Imaging Supervisor, a level I supervisor is considered a working supervisor with little authority for personnel actions. Being a Document Imaging Supervisor may require a bachelor's degree in area of specialty.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. Working team member that may validate or coordinate the work of others on a support team. Suggests improvements to process, is a knowledge resource for other team members. Has no authority for staff actions. Generally has a minimum of 2 years experience as an individual contributor. Thorough knowledge of the team process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    FY20-004: Large Scale Scanning Support Services Candidates shall work to support requirements as a Document Management Work/Technical Lead (Document Management, Imaging, And Archiving) and provide document management, imaging, and archiving services to The United States Department of Energy (DOE) Hanford Site (Richland Operations Office (RL), and Office of River Protection (ORP). 

    The ProSidian Document Management, Imaging, And Archiving Team will scan various records from long term records storage or other locations. Potential record media types may include: a) Paper records; b) Microfilm/microfiche; c) X-rays; d) Photographs; e) Maps; or f) Other record type(s) deemed suitable for preservation.

    • Equipment Required:  Equipment required for performance of this service will be provided by the government. Services may be conducted at multiple locations. ProSidian Consulting shall ensure the maximum utilization of the equipment via scheduling of the workforce within funding provided. Unusual schedules should be coordinated and approved by the Program Official (PO) prior to commencement of work. No additional funds will be expended for overtime unless approved in writing by the Contracting Officer in advance. 
    • Identification Of Boxes To Scan:  In consultation with ProSidian Consulting, the PO/Records Management Field Officer (RMO) will determine which record collections will be completed in which order. ProSidian Consulting will work with the records storage contractor to coordinate record delivery, staging, and return. 
    • Preparation Of The Records:  To prepare the records, appropriate actions are to be taken, i.e. removing of staples, removing pages from prongs, etc.  The appropriate preparation will depend on the specific record format.  After scanning, the records are to be returned in the format determined by the PO, RMO, and/or record customer.  
    • Scanning Of The Record:  The entire personnel or other similar record is to be scanned into a separate folder in the provided shared area on the Hanford network.  The scanned image shall be quality checked to ensure the entire document was captured in the scan and is legible, clear, and unblemished. Utilizing the provided index or similar process, ProSidian Consulting will ensure that all records in the collection were captured.  The file will be reduced following specific directions provided.  The image will be linked to a provided index existing in the Hanford Employment Record Explorer or other records process, depending on the records collection and as determined by the PO, RMO, and/or record customer.

Richland (/ˈrɪtʃlənd/) is a city in Benton County in the southeastern part of the State of Washington, at the confluence of the Yakima and the Columbia Rivers. As of the 2010 census, the city's population was 48,058. July 1, 2017, estimates from the Census Bureau put the city's population at 56,243. Along with the nearby cities of Pasco and Kennewick, Richland is one of the Tri-Cities, and is home to the Hanford nuclear site.
